How do I set up a claims management system for cleaner submission and faster denial follow-up?
Latest observation
A good claims management system should do two things well:
- Make every claim submission consistent and complete
- Make every denial easy to track, assign, and resolve quickly
Here’s a practical setup you can use.
1) Start with a standard claims workflow
Build a simple end-to-end process and make it the same for every claim:
Intake → Verification → Submission → Follow-up → Denial review → Appeal/resubmission → Payment posting → Reporting
For each step, define:
- Who owns it
- What inputs are required
- What “done” means
- What happens if it stalls
This keeps claims from getting lost in email, spreadsheets, or tribal knowledge.
2) Use a centralized claims tracking system
Whether you use claims software, an EHR module, or a well-designed spreadsheet at first, track every claim in one place.
Minimum fields to track
- Patient / account ID
- Payer
- Claim ID
- DOS or service date
- CPT/HCPCS / procedure codes
- ICD-10 / diagnosis codes
- Charge amount
- Submission date
- Clearinghouse status
- Payer status
- Denial code / reason
- Denial date
- Follow-up owner
- Next action date
- Appeal deadline
- Final resolution / paid / written off
Nice-to-have fields
- Authorizations obtained?
- Eligibility verified?
- Timely filing deadline
- Attachments sent?
- Prior auth reference number
- Notes and call reference numbers
3) Standardize claim submission before it goes out
Most clean-claim issues come from missing or mismatched data. Add a “pre-submission checklist” so claims get validated before filing.
Clean-claim checklist
- Patient demographics match the payer record
- Insurance is active on date of service
- Prior authorization is on file if required
- Referring provider info is complete if needed
- CPT/HCPCS and ICD-10 codes are valid and linked correctly
- Modifiers are correct
- NPI/TIN and billing provider details are accurate
- Place of service is correct
- Attachments are included when required
- Patient responsibility rules are applied correctly
- Coordination of benefits is complete
- Claim meets payer-specific formatting rules
Best practice
Create payer-specific rules. A claim that’s clean for one payer may be rejected by another.
4) Build payer-specific rules and edits
Make a simple rules library for your top payers:
- Required fields
- Authorization requirements
- Bundling/edit issues
- Timely filing limits
- Documentation needs
- Common denial reasons and fixes
If your system supports it, configure:
- hard edits to stop bad claims before submission
- soft edits to warn staff but allow review
This can dramatically reduce rework.
5) Set up denial categories and root-cause codes
Don’t just record “denied.” Categorize denials so you can fix the source issue.
Common denial categories
- Eligibility/coverage
- Prior authorization
- Medical necessity
- Coding/modifier
- Duplicate claim
- Timely filing
- Coordination of benefits
- Missing documentation
- Provider enrollment/network issue
- Authorization mismatch
- Payer processing error
Root-cause fields
- Department responsible
- Preventable vs non-preventable
- First occurrence date
- Repeat frequency
- Fix applied
This helps identify recurring problems instead of treating every denial as isolated.
6) Create a denial follow-up queue
Build a work queue that automatically prioritizes denials by urgency.
Prioritize by:
- Appeal deadline
- Timely filing window
- Claim dollar amount
- Payer type
- Aging
- Complexity
- Probability of recovery
Workflow suggestion
Assign every denial:
- Owner
- Due date
- Action type: corrected claim, appeal, medical records, call payer, patient contact
- Status: open, in progress, pending payer, appealed, resolved
This prevents denials from sitting untouched.
7) Use templates for appeals and payer follow-up
Create standardized templates for:
- Denial appeal letters
- Corrected claim cover sheets
- Medical necessity letters
- Payer phone call scripts
- Fax/email request forms
Templates should include:
- Claim number
- Member ID
- DOS
- Denial reason
- Requested action
- Supporting documentation list
- Contact information
This speeds up response times and keeps messaging consistent.
8) Put deadlines on everything
Speed depends on urgency, so track and alert on key dates:
- Claim submission deadline
- Payer response window
- Appeal deadline
- Medical records deadline
- Resubmission deadline
- Timely filing deadline
Use reminders or automated alerts so staff know what’s due next.
9) Automate what you can
Even simple automation helps a lot.
Useful automations
- Route denials by code to the right team
- Auto-create follow-up tasks
- Send alerts when claims age past a threshold
- Flag missing data before submission
- Generate daily denial reports
- Escalate high-dollar or near-deadline claims
If you have the capability, integrate your billing system with clearinghouse, payer portals, and document management.
10) Create performance dashboards
Measure what matters so you can improve the process.
Key metrics
- Clean claim rate
- First-pass resolution rate
- Denial rate
- Denial overturn rate
- Average days to follow up
- Average days in A/R
- Appeal success rate
- Rework rate
- Top denial reasons
- Claims missed timely filing
Review these weekly or monthly.
11) Define roles clearly
Claims work gets messy when responsibilities are unclear.
Example roles
- Front desk / intake: demographics, insurance capture, eligibility
- Authorization team: referrals, prior auth, referrals
- Coding/billing: coding accuracy, claim edits
- Claims submission team: claim creation and release
- Denial management team: follow-up, appeals, tracking
- Manager: escalation, trends, payer issues
If a denial occurs, one person should own the next step.
12) Build a feedback loop to prevent repeat denials
The best denial management systems don’t just recover money—they reduce future denials.
Weekly review questions
- What were the top denial reasons?
- Which payer is creating the most delays?
- Are denials coming from intake, auth, coding, or billing?
- What issue can be fixed at the source?
- What rule or checklist needs updating?
Then update your workflows, training, and edits.
13) Start simple, then mature the system
If you’re not ready for full software, start with:
- A shared tracker
- Standard intake checklist
- Denial categories
- Task ownership
- Weekly aging report
As volume grows, move to:
- Claims management software
- Automated workflow routing
- Payer-specific rule engines
- Dashboards and analytics
A simple setup blueprint
Claim submission side
- Collect complete patient and insurance data
- Verify eligibility and authorization
- Run claim edits
- Submit clean claims
- Track acceptance/rejection
Denial side
- Denial enters queue automatically
- Categorize denial reason
- Assign owner and due date
- Gather documentation
- Appeal or resubmit
- Post resolution
- Log root cause for reporting
Common mistakes to avoid
- Letting denials sit in inboxes
- Not tracking appeal deadlines
- Using free-text notes instead of structured fields
- Ignoring payer-specific rules
- Failing to assign ownership
- Not reviewing trends
- Mixing submission work with denial work without clear queues
If you want the fastest improvement
Focus on these first:
- Clean-claim checklist
- Centralized denial tracker
- Owner + due date on every denial
- Payer-specific denial codes
- Weekly aging and trend report
That combination usually gives the biggest lift in cleaner submission and faster follow-up.
